Nissan eyeing Thailand as production base for global strategic vehicle

 

 Nissan Motor Co, Japan’s third-largest automaker by sales, plans to produce a 1-liter global strategic vehicle for developing countries in Thailand from 2010, the Nikkei reported on Wednesday, without citing sources.

2008 All new Honda Jazz was unveiled in Thailand

Honda Automobile (Thailand) Co aims to sell 32,000 units of the all-new Jazz at home and abroad this year.

“We are confident we can achieve the target, given the innovative design and impressive features. The model is a very smart choice among many customers in the region,” said president Kenji Otaka, who joined Honda executives to launch the second-generation model at a Bangkok hotel yesterday.

GM’s promise: A car cheaper than its Spark

 

General Motors may have been a little slow in capturing the India growth story but it is trying hard to make up for lost time. The company, which lays claim to barely 3 per cent of the domestic passenger car market, is pulling out many stops to script the growth saga: a second small car priced lower than the Spark is under development and if things work out well, low-cost commercial vehicles such as pick-ups and vans would also be sold in India.

The auto giant’s second manufacturing facility with 1.4 lakh unit annual capacity at Talegaon is ready for trial production; a separate powertrain facility is also already in the works.

Improved Nissan Navara gains three star rating

 

Euro NCAP today releases results for its assessment of the modified Nissan Navara. The upgraded car has achieved three stars for adult occupant protection. After Euro NCAP’s earlier tests highlighted serious safety concerns, Nissan promptly modified all new production vehicles and initiated a Service Campaign to upgrade the airbag software of all Navaras produced since 2005.

Euro NCAP recently released a struck-through one star rating for the 08 model year Navara. The poor rating was due in part to the delayed firing of the airbag in the frontal impact test. Nissan reacted swiftly and developed new airbag software to ensure better occupant protection. Production Navaras are now equipped with the improved software and an extensive Service Campaign is underway to upgrade owners’ vehicles .
